Timezone in Mount Egerton

Mount Egerton is located in the Australia/Melbourne timezone, which has a UTC offset of +10:00 during standard time. This timezone observes daylight saving time, which begins on the first Sunday in October and ends on the first Sunday in April. During daylight saving time, the offset changes to UTC +11:00.

Attractions and Activities in Mount Egerton

Mount Egerton is a small locality in Victoria, Australia, known for its natural beauty and rural charm. Nestled in a picturesque setting, the area features rolling hills and lush landscapes typical of the Australian countryside. The region is primarily residential and agricultural, with a strong sense of community among its residents.

While Mount Egerton may not boast major tourist attractions, it offers a glimpse into the tranquil rural lifestyle of Victoria. The nearby Werribee River and surrounding bushland provide op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king and birdwatching. The area is also characterized by its historic buildings and remnants of its gold mining past, which contribute to the local heritage.

Culturally, Mount Egerton reflects a close-knit community with a focus on local events and gatherings that foster connections among residents. The region is a part of the broader Ballarat area, which is known for its rich history and cultural significance, particularly related to the Victorian gold rush.

Practical Information for Visitors

Mount Egerton is located in Victoria, Australia, and is accessible via various transport options. The nearest major airport is Melbourne Airport, which is about an hour’s drive away. From there, you can rent a car or take a bus to Ballarat and then a regional train to the nearest station.

Local buses may also connect you from Ballarat to Mount Egerton, though services can be limited. The weather in Mount Egerton typically features a temperate climate, with warm summers and cool winters. Average temperatures range from 5°C in winter to around 25°C in summer.

The best time to visit is during spring and autumn when the weather is mild and the landscapes are at their most vibrant.
